Re: My bad words filter does not work.
The badwords filter seems to be working as you have a post with two blocked words in your guestbook (first page, post by Nicholas).
To add your own words to the filter it doesn't really matter if they are up or above the "/* INSERT NEW BAD WORDS BELOW THIS LINE */" line - this is just a guide for people who are not familiar with PHP so they don't break the code and make GBook unusable.
You can simply add new words just below
/* INSERT NEW BAD WORDS BELOW THIS LINE */
Make sure you use this exact format:
If you can't get it to work paste your entire code here so we can check for errors.

Re: My bad words filter does not work.
No, "pest" => "* * *" should equally ban "pest", "pest," and also isn't case sensitive (it will ban "PEST,").
And no, the filter doesn't work retro-actively, it will only effect new posts.
